Guilty Pleasure: Black Twitter Trends Over White People Songs Black People Love

AME Choppa had Black Twitter lit.

A tweet from AME Choppa went viral after the user turned a negative into a positive on Wednesday. Turning the spotlight on Black Twitter, the person asked Black folks to post their favorite songs by white people that would make them go viral.

“Black People: Let’s flip the table. If you were at a party and they caught you on camera singing a White people song, which artist/song would make you go viral?”

And the hilarious tweets rolled in. 

Of course, someone posted Black folks’ guilty pleasure 2005’s “I Write Sins Not Tragedies” by alt-indie band Panic At The Disco.

Twitter user I Am Me raised Panic At The Disco with Vanessa Carlton’s “A Thousand Miles,” featured in 2004’s Wayans’ Brothers comedy classic White Chicks.

Another person had Alanis Morisette’s Grammy-award winning single “You Oughta Know” from 1995 on lock.

And Black Twitter would be remiss if it didn’t mention Natalie Imbruglia’s “Torn.”

A Black Twitter delegate also posted a video of a man Crip-walking to Natasha Bedingfield’s “Unwritten.”

Twitter user Flawda Perc hit the folks over the head with Gotye’s “Somebody That I Used To Know.”

AME Choppa’s now-viral tweet came in response to a tweet of two white girls rapping Lil Baby’s lyrics on April 26.
